MariaDB CHR() 函数使用指南
在 MariaDB 中, CHR() 是一个内置的字符串函数,它将指定的整数参数转为对应的字符并返回。
CHR() 与 CHAR() 函数不同, CHAR() 函数可接受多个参数,并且可以通过 USING 子句指定要使用的字符集。
MariaDB CHR() 语法
这里是 MariaDB CHR() 函数的语法:
CHR(num)
参数
num- 必需的。一个整数,或者能转为整数的值。
-
如果您传入了多个参数,MariaDB 将报告错误:ERROR 1582 (42000): Incorrect parameter count in the call to native function ‘CHR’。
返回值
MariaDB CHR() 函数返回有整数参数对应的字符。
如果你提供了一个 NULL 值, CHR() 函数将返回 NULL。
MariaDB CHAR() 示例
下面的语句使用 MariaDB CHR() 函数返回 65 对应的字符:
SELECT CHR(65);
输出:
+---------+
| CHR(65) |
+---------+
| A |
+---------+CHR() 与 ASCII() 的计算过程是相反的,下面的示例展示了这一点:
SELECT CHR(65), ASCII(CHR(65));
输出:
+---------+----------------+
| CHR(65) | ASCII(CHR(65)) |
+---------+----------------+
| A | 65 |
+---------+----------------+结论
在 MariaDB 中, CHR() 是一个内置的字符串函数,它将指定的整数参数转为对应的字符并返回。